If c.p = 700 s.p= 665 find loss and loss percent​

Answer:

35 and 5%

Step-by-step explanation:

loss = cp - sp = 700 - 665 = 35

% loss = \frac{loss}{cp} × 100%

          = \frac{35}{700} × 100%

          = \frac{35}{7}

         = 5%

If log(a) = 1.2 and log(b)= 5.6, what is log(a/b)?

Answer:

d. -4.4​

Step-by-step explanation:

We know that log (a/b) = log a - log b

Since log a = 1.2 and log b = 5.6 , we can substitute these values into the equation.

                        log (a/b)  =   1.2 - 5.6

                                       = -4.4
